Transaction 3ba21b8077566b606bd56426131380c105fb306a7e5a2475734261d63b92ea96
1 Input
1 Output
-
3ba21b8077566b606bd56426131380c105fb306a7e5a2475734261d63b92ea96:0
- value
- 49327489
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 56e764c547f73c3c362f88c1e7be4f6420159896 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18vWK1XTEk3xgQjHfCbQSHegdVya2VgenP